Germany Solves Unbanked Problem By Giving Bank Accounts To Everyone

By June 19, 2016Bitcoin Business

Bitcoin is often seen as a perfect solution to solve the unbanked problems in the world. But over in Germany, the government is taking matters into their own hands. As of June 19, every citizen in Germany should have access to a bank account and at a reasonable price. All of the banks in the country have to offer this service to unbanked citizens from now on. Removing The Unbanked Problem

There is an argument to be made as to why some people would prefer to remain unbanked . Relying on the banking system means giving up financial privacy, whereas cash payments do not require personal information. But at the same time, more and more countries want to get rid of cash altogether, forcing consumers into the waiting arms of financial institutions.

Things are quite different in Germany, though. As of today, every bank in the country must offer a fairly-priced bank account to potential customers. A law was passed by the government recently, which enforced this rule. The discussion about providing this service to unbanked citizens dates back to 2012 and is an initiative by the banks themselves.

Moreover, there is an EU guideline which forces financial institutions to offer a bank account to unbanked people from now on. Up until this point, very few organizations willingly provided services to homeless and other less fortunate individuals. But the new guidelines forces all banks to provide these people an account, as long as the individual is a legal citizen within the EU.
